What you'll do

  • Lead technical strategy and execution for Underwriting systems.
  • Design and develop high-performance platforms using modern frameworks and tools.
  • Implement AI solutions to enhance efficiency in Underwriting tasks.
  • Mentor engineers and coach them on technical expertise and best practices.
  • Influence leadership by educating on technological advancements and trends.

What we're looking for

  • 12+ years of professional software development experience in Java or similar modern languages.
  • Expertise in designing and improving systems with focus on architecture excellence, reliability, and scalability.
  • Proficiency in micro-services oriented architecture using gRPC interfaces and event-driven systems with Kafka.
  • Fluency in DevOps concepts, cloud architecture, and operational tools across major cloud providers like AWS, Azure, GCP.
  • Experience in contin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D) and infrastructure as code practices.
  • Strong background in application monitoring, performance tuning, and security protocols including directory services and OAuth.
